Staying hydrated is essential for well-being and health. However, not all beverages are equally effective in meeting our hydration needs. In this article, we will explore the best options to keep your body in optimal condition, based on the latest information.
Proper hydration is crucial for the body’s functioning. Water regulates body temperature, transports nutrients, and removes waste. Insufficient fluid intake can lead to various health issues, ranging from fatigue to more serious complications.
Water is the most effective drink for staying hydrated. It contains no calories or added sugars, making it ideal for anyone looking to maintain a healthy lifestyle. Experts recommend consuming between 2 to 3 liters of water per day, depending on physical activity and climate.
Isotonic drinks are particularly useful for people who engage in intense exercise or sweat a lot. They are designed to quickly replenish electrolytes and fluids lost during physical activity. These beverages usually contain sodium, potassium, and carbohydrates, making them suitable for post-workout recovery.
Tea infusions, both hot and cold, are an excellent option for hydration. Green tea, for example, not only hydrates but also provides beneficial antioxidants for health. Moreover, it is low in calories when prepared without sugar. Herbal infusions such as mint or hibiscus are also refreshing and deeply hydrating.
Milk, both whole and skimmed, is another drink that contributes to hydration. In fact, some studies have shown that milk may be even more effective than water for rehydrating after exercise. This is due to its content of proteins and electrolytes.
Coconut water is a natural beverage rich in electrolytes that has become very popular among those looking to stay hydrated. Its nutritional profile is similar to that of isotonic drinks, making it an excellent option for recovery after physical effort.
Sugary drinks, such as sodas and processed juices, can make you feel thirstier. The high sugar content can lead to quick dehydration and do not provide the benefits that the body needs.
Although coffee and alcohol can be enjoyed in moderation, they are not the best options for staying hydrated. Both beverages can have a diuretic effect, which means they can make you lose more fluids than they provide.
If you wish to maintain an adequate level of hydration, choose the drinks mentioned above and ensure you incorporate enough water into your daily routine. Remember that individual needs can vary, so it is important to pay attention to your body’s signals.
